What is an AI powered workflow for Zendesk support?

For a long time, "automation" in Zendesk just meant setting up macros and triggers. These are classic, rule-based systems that run on simple "if this, then that" logic. For example, if a ticket has the word "refund" in it, it gets sent to the billing team. It’s helpful for basic sorting, but it’s not smart. It doesn't get the nuance or context of what a customer is actually trying to say.

A modern, AI-powered workflow is a completely different ballgame. It uses what some people call "agentic AI," which acts less like a rigid rulebook and more like a new team member. This kind of AI can read an entire ticket and understand the important stuff: what the customer wants (intent), how they're feeling about it (sentiment), and the language they're using.

Instead of just slapping a tag on a ticket, a real AI workflow can actually get things done. It can talk to your other tools to pull information (like checking an order status in Shopify), string together multiple steps to resolve an issue by itself, and even draft personalized replies based on your company's voice and past tickets.

The whole idea is to let the AI handle the repetitive, time-sucking tasks on its own. This frees up your human agents to put their brainpower toward the complex, high-stakes issues where they can make the biggest difference.

Zendesk's native features for AI powered workflows

Before we get into the downsides, it’s only fair to cover what Zendesk’s own AI can do. They’ve added a few features aimed at making support life easier, but you’ll find they mostly act as helpers for your human agents, not as true, autonomous problem-solvers.

Intelligent triage

Zendesk's main tool for sorting tickets is called "Intelligent Triage." It uses AI to scan incoming messages and guess the customer's intent, language, and sentiment. With that guess, it can add some tags and route the ticket to the right group. It’s definitely a step up from basic keyword triggers and can help tickets land in the right place faster, but its decisions are based only on what’s inside that single ticket.

Zendesk Copilot for agent assistance

Zendesk Copilot is a set of tools designed to help your human agents work faster. It’s like an AI sidekick for your team. It can summarize long ticket threads so an agent can catch up quickly, suggest macros they might want to use, and use generative AI to turn a few bullet points into a full response or adjust the tone of a message. It's nice for speeding up manual tasks, but it’s all about assisting people, not resolving tickets from start to finish.

AI agents for basic automation

Zendesk also has AI agents, but these are mostly built to deflect simple questions by finding answers in your Zendesk Help Center. They can handle the low-hanging fruit, but their success hinges entirely on how thorough and current your Zendesk Guide articles are. If the answer isn't in your help center, the bot has nowhere else to look and gives up.

Unpacking the pricing model

Most of Zendesk's advanced AI features aren't part of the standard Suite plans. To unlock them, you have to buy pricey add-ons for each agent, like the Zendesk Copilot. These costs can pile up in a hurry, especially if your team is growing.

Plan / Add-OnCost (per agent/month)Key AI Features Included
Zendesk Suite Team$55 (billed annually)Basic AI agents (requires Help Center add-on), Generative replies.
Zendesk Suite Professional$115 (billed annually)Everything in Team plus skills-based routing, SLA management.
Zendesk Copilot Add-OnAdditional fee per agent/monthIntelligent triage, generative AI tools for agents (summarize, expand), macro suggestions, auto-replies.
Advanced AI Agents Add-OnAdditional fee per agent/monthMore autonomous agents that can reason and take action on their own.

Pro Tip
Paying for AI per agent can become a real budget killer. Every time you hire a new person, your AI bill jumps, even if the number of tickets your AI resolves stays exactly the same. This model basically penalizes you for growing your support team.
